I think it's worth considering Waste Not

Aside from diabolic tutor you could consider running cards with Transmute to tutor up cards. Dimir Infiltrator Tutors for 2 CMC cards Perplex Tutos for 3 CMC cards Dimir House Guard Tutors for 4 CMC cards

Since a lot of your deck is from 2 to 4 mana I think these would provide cheap efficient tutors.

rick132 while I do like the idea of Waste Not I do not feel like I run enough discard effects to make a decent use of the card. I also like your suggestion of more transmute effects however I feel like the tutors are too strict for me. Diabolic Tutor can fetch anything I need for the current situation. While transmute cards can only fetch a few cards for a few situations.

Grixis776 says... #15

hkhssweiss I will add Nicol Bolas, God-Pharaoh eventually, I believe he is very powerful and deserves a spot in the deck. I will not be adding Nicol Bolas, the Deceiver as I feel he is not powerful enough for 8 mana.

I do like all of your ramp suggestions and will use them if I feel the deck needs more mana-fixing/ramp.

Sweltering Suns and Cower in Fear are too weak to be good in this deck. Sadistic Sacrament is so cruel and so awesome! That card can single handedly take out an opponents chances of winning so I will definitely throw that card in at some point. Countersquall is an auto-include as it’s an on flavour Negate. I removed Slave of Bolas because I felt it was too much mana for the results it produced. Crux of Fate is definitely strong and I will consider it. The only problem with the card is if I come up against a deck with a large amount of dragons. Blood Reckoning will almost never stop the token decks from killing me so I decide not to run it. Imp's Mischief while on flavour, can easily be replaced with a copy of Redirect so that I don’t lose life. Great suggestions!

Supreme Will is a Bolas-themed counter spell that I love. It feels better to hold up than most counter spells because if nothing happens that needs countering, you can just dig 4 deep and grab the best card.
